Slow cooked Beef Pot Roast

Ingredients:

  • 2kg roast beef (like topside or sirloin)
  • 2 heads of garlic, tops cut off (reserve tops)
  • 30ml olive oil
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 2 carrots, peeled and chopped
  • 50g tomato paste
  • 1 packet oxtail soup powder
  • 250ml red wine
  • 1L beef stock
  • 4 sprigs of rosemary
  • How it’s done:
  1. Preheat the oven to 200°C. Make incisions in the meat with a small, sharp knife and stuff each with an off-cut of garlic.
  2. Heat the oil over high heat and brown the meat all over. Add the onions, carrots and tomato paste and cook for 2 minutes. Add the oxtail soup, red wine and 250ml of the beef stock and cook for 3 minutes. Add the rest of the stock, garlic and rosemary sprigs. Cover and roast for 30 minutes.
  3. Turn the temperature down to 175°C and roast for 30 minutes. Uncover and roast for 15 minutes. Allow to rest for at least 15 minutes before carving.image00.jpg
